Political comic artist Thomas Nast based his illustrations of Uncle Sam on Rice and his outfit. Dan Rice was an achieved pet fitness instructor. He specialized in pigs and mules, which he educated and sold to other clowns. He also presented an act with a qualified rhinoceros and is the only individual in circus background to present a tightrope walking elephant.


He was likewise a benefactor that gave generously to numerous charities and he put up the first monument to soldiers eliminated during the Civil Battle - Party clown. Beginnings of the Auguste characterThere is an extensively informed tale about the origins of the Auguste clown. According to the tale, an American acrobat called Tom Belling was performing with a circus in Germany in 1869


The supervisor suddenly entered the room. Belling took off running, winding up in the circus sector where he tipped over the ringcurb. In his humiliation and rush to get away, he dropped over the ringcurb once again on his method out. The audience screamed, "auguste!" which is German for fool. The manager regulated that Belling proceed appearing as the Auguste.

For one point, words Auguste did not exist in the German language till after the character became preferred. One of the theories of the real beginning is that Belling copied the character from the R'izhii (Red Haired) clowns he saw when he toured Russia with a circus (https://all0ccperf0rm.mystrikingly.com/). Characters like the auguste absolutely existed previously

No person understands where the mummers' plays and Morris dances came from. In such plays there is a combination of personalities consisting of "kings" and "saints", cross-dressing, and blackface roles; the faces of Morris (or "Moorish") professional dancers were additionally blackened. The mummer's plays were not for fun. The majority of were carried out by paupers in the starving time after Xmas.


The Derby Play of the Tup was executed for food and beer by out of work youths. One such demonstration has actually entered American history as the Boston Tea Celebration.

While not the lush affairs we think about today, some early, rougher types of taking a trip circus were popular in America from Revolutionary times-- George Washington was a follower. Blackface clowns performed in them from at the very least the 1810s and perhaps prior to; they were a staple by the 1820s. The wide red or white mouth repainted on by modern-day clowns is a residue of the blackface mask.




In several respects minstrelsy was birthed when these entertainers relocated their acts from the camping tent to the stage of American selection theaters. There was a solid aspect of clowning in minstrelsy. The blackface mask was a clown's camouflage, overemphasizing the face attributes into an animation, a caricature. The blackface clown may be the precursor of today's anodyne circus clown, yet otherwise both are as opposite as blackface and whiteface.

He worked numerous London movie theaters utilizing the stage name Joey. Joseph Grimaldi contributions to the growth of clowning is so revered that in clown circles today a fellow clown is usually referred to as a Joey. Grimaldi painted his face white and included styles of red triangulars to his cheeks.
